Summary

Liverpool is actively discussing potential transfer moves as preparations for the 2026-27 season continue. Richard Hughes remains focused on improving the squad after a summer of high expenditure, with concerns about defensive depth due to injuries. With three center-backs sidelined, the team is reportedly prioritizing a new full-back to bolster the back line. The club is also considering the contributions of academy graduates Kieran Morrison, Trey Nyoni, and Calvin Ramsay for the upcoming season. Discussions on new signings are already underway, especially as the Premier League season approaches.
